The Imo State Council of Nigeria Union of Journalists , NUJ has clarified that popular activist, Theodore Chinonso Ubah (alias Nonsonkwa) is not a member of the union.
The disclaimer is contained in a statement dated Friday, October 18, 2024 and signed by Comrade Ifeanyi Nwanguma and Treasurer Ihechi-Nwamah, Chairman and Secretary respectively of the union.
The union further declared that Nonsonkwa is not a journalist by training hence is not a member of the Imo NUJ.
It also dissociated the leadership and members of the union from the activities of the said Nonsonkwa.
The union added that Nonsonkwa should be held responsible for his actions and inactions, stressing that activities of the activist should not be linked to the union or journalists in the state.
The statement reads; "It has come to the attention of the Nigeria Union of Journalists, NUJ, Imo State Council of the activities of some persons who parade themselves as journalists and by extension, Imo NUJ members.
"Among these said persons is one Mr. Chinonso Uba, also known as Nonso Nkwa, who we have on our record is not a journalist by training; hence not a member of Imo NUJ.
"Therefore, we want to use this medium to once again, dissociate the leadership and the entire members of Imo NUJ from the activities of the said Nonso Nkwa.
"We also wish to state that Nonso Nkwa should be held responsible for his actions and inactions; and such should not be linked to Imo NUJ or journalists in the state furthermore.
"The recent attack on NOUN and JAMB office at Ehime Mbano LGA is an instance and for such to be linked to somebody masquerading himself as journalist cum a member of Imo NUJ is most unfortunate and unacceptable to us.
"Imo NUJ condemned in its entirety the act of inciting youths against the Imo Government, security agencies in the state and Imo citizens at large.
